The specimen is ruby in zoisite and is from India. Ruby is red corundum which has a hardness of 9 on Moh's scale of hardness. The zoisite is softer, probably somewhere around 5 or 6. Since the purpose of these specimens is generally for fluorescent display, most of the specimens are cut thinner than slabs would normally be cut if they were to be used for making cabs. Thinner cuts allow us to show more of the corundum crystals, which would otherwise be lost inside the matrix. A few of the slabs were cut thick enough for cabbing and will be so noted in the stat's under the image below.
The first image was taken under long wave ultraviolet light. The corundum fluoresces a nice cherry red under long wave and a dull weak cherry red under short wave. Due to the weakness of the short wave image we elected not to include a short wave image on the site for these specimens.
The image below was taken under normal lighting. The specimen is shown as cut. I am not certain how well the zoisite will take a polish. Since the ruby is a 9 in hardness, it should polish well.
